Diagnostic trouble code: P0336 “Malfunction of improper signal of crankshaft
position sensor”

Item

No.

Operation procedure

Inspection

results

Follow-up procedure

1

Connect the diagnostic tester and
adaptor, and turn the ignition switch to
“OFF” position.

Proceed to next step.

Yes

Proceed to next step.

2

Disconnect the connector of rotary
sensor on the wiring harness, inspect
with multimeter to verify that the
resistance between 2# pin and 3# pin of
this rotary sensor is about 770~950Ω
under 20

.

No

Replace the sensor.

Yes

Repair and replace

the wiring harness.

3

Verify that the circuits between 2# and
3# pin of the rotary sensor connector and
34# and 15# pins of ECU are open, or are
short to ground or power supply.

No

Proceed to next step.

Yes

Refer to diagnosis

help.

4

Verify that the signal panel of flywheel is
in good condition.

No

Replace the signal

panel.


Diagnostic trouble code: P0340 “Malfunction of phase angle sensor signal”

Item

No.

Operation procedure

Inspection

results

Follow-up

procedure

1

Connect the diagnostic tester and adaptor,
and turn the ignition switch to “ON”
position.

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Proceed to Step 4

2

Disconnect the connector of phase angle
sensor on the wiring harness, inspect with
multimeter to verify that the voltage
between 1# pin and 3# pin of this phase
angle sensor connector is about 12V.

No

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Repair or replace

the wiring

harness.

3

Verify that the circuit between 3# pin of
phase angle sensor and 87# pin of the main
relay is open or short to ground;
Verify that 1# pin of phase angle sensor is
grounded properly.

No

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Proceed to Step 6

4

Verify that the voltage between 2# pin of
the phase angle sensor connector and the
negative grid of power supply is about 9.9V.

No

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Repair or replace

the wiring

harness.

5

Verify that the circuit between 2# pin of the
phase angle sensor connector and 79# pin of
ECU is open, or is short to ground or power
supply.

No

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Refer to diagnosis

help.

6

Verify that the signal panel of camshaft is in
good condition.

No

Replace the signal

panel.


Diagnostic trouble code: P0443 “Malfunction in control circuit of drive stage of
carbon canister control valve”

Item

No.

Operation procedure

Inspection

results

Follow-up

procedure

1

Connect the diagnostic tester and adaptor, and
turn the ignition switch to “ON” position.

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Proceed to Step

4

2

Disconnect the connector of carbon canister
control valve on the wiring harness, inspect
with multimeter to verify that the voltage
between 1# pin of this connector and the
negative grid of power supply is about 12V.

No

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Repair or

replace the

wiring harness.

3

Verify that the power supply circuit of carbon
canister control valve is open or short to
ground.

No

Proceed to Step

2

Yes

Proceed to next

step.

4

Inspect with multimeter to verify that the
resistance between 1# and 2# pins of carbon
canister control valve is within 22-30Ω under
20

.

No

Replace the

control valve.

Yes

Refer to

diagnosis help.

5

Inspect with multimeter to verify that the
voltage between 1# pin of carbon canister
control valve connector and the negative grid
of power supply is about 3.7V.

No

Proceed to next

step.

Yes

Repair or

replace the

wiring harness.

6

Verify that the circuit between 2# pin of
carbon canister control valve connector and
46# pin of ECU is open.

No

Refer to

diagnosis help.

Diagnostic trouble code: P0444 “Undervoltage in control circuit of drive stage of
carbon canister control valve”

Item

No.

Operation procedure

Inspection

results

Follow-up procedure

1

Connect the diagnostic tester and
adaptor, and turn the ignition switch to
“ON” position.

Proceed to next step.

Yes

Proceed to Step 4

2

Disconnect the connector of carbon
canister control valve on the wiring
harness, inspect with multimeter to
verify that the voltage between 1# pin
of this connector and the negative grid
of power supply is about 12V.

No

Proceed to next step.

Yes

Repair or replace the

wiring harness.

3

Verify that the power supply circuit of
carbon canister control valve is open
or short to ground.

No

Proceed to Step 2

Yes

Proceed to next step.

4

Inspect with multimeter to verify that
the resistance between 1# and 2# pins
of carbon canister control valve is
within 22-30Ω under 20

.

No

Replace the control

valve.

Yes

Refer to diagnosis

help.

5

Inspect with multimeter to verify that
the voltage between 1# pin of carbon
canister control valve connector and
the negative grid of power supply is
about 3.7V.

No

Proceed to next step.

Yes

Repair or replace the

wiring harness.

6

Verify that the circuit between 2# pin
of carbon canister control valve
connector and 46# pin of ECU is short
to ground.

No

Refer to diagnosis

help.
